17-60 Encoder Positive Direction
Option:
*Clockwise [0]
Counterclockwise [1]
Function:
Changes the detected enc oder directi
on (revolution)
without changing the wires to the encoder. Select
Clockwise when A channel is 90° (electrical de grees)
before channel B by clockwise ro
tation of the
encoder shaft. S elect Counterclockwise when A
channel is 90° (electrical degrees) after channel B by
clockwise rotation of the enc
oder shaft. Par. 17-60
cannot be changed while the motor is running.
